I am a Junior Research Fellow in the Dive Fisheries Research Group at the Institute for Marine and Antarctic Studies (IMAS). My work involves a variety of fieldwork, experiments and lab work.
I studied for my PhD at IMAS, working on the role of Southern Rock Lobsters in controlling the range-extending, barren-forming Longspined Sea Urchin on the east coast of Tasmania.
